Binay enjoyed Cebu’s crunchy ‘lechon’ but…

By: Marc Eric Cosep October 11,2015 - 02:31 AM

VICE President Jejomar Binay arrived late for last Friday’s visit to the Vicente Sotto Memorial Medical Center with Sen. Nancy Binay to donate IV fluids for dengue patients.

He apologized for being late, saying he needed to have his dentures fixed.

He  damaged them when he ate the crunchy skin of lechon (roasted pig).

“Cebu lechon is very flavorsome and I deeply apologize for being late because I went to Gaisano Country Mall to fix my dentures,” Binay said.

The vice president was here for the Visayas launching of his party United Nationalist Alliance (UNA) and his presidential bid.

“If given a chance to be the president, I’ll give housing programs to the poor especially in Eastern Visayas,” Binay said.

His daughter,  Nancy, said the overall number of dengue cases in the country runs to  95,000 cases with more than 300 deaths in 10 months.

“A few weeks ago, my daughter was admitted in  the hospital for  dengue. I feel the need to help  Filipinos in this situation, ” the senator said.

Sen. Binay said VSMMC Chief of Clinics Dr. Roques Paradella told her that 30 patients  have been  admitted in different hospitals in Cebu City.

She said the number of dengue cases is higher this year but there are fewer deaths.

She said she filed a resolution seeking a regular outlay for dengue assistance especially during the rainy season,” Sen. Binay said.
